Frequently asked questions

What is The Flora-Bama Yacht Club known for?

It is best known for seafood dishes and drinks, especially oysters, crab cakes, gumbo, and the bushwacker. Reviewers also call out the waterfront setting and live music, which make it a popular stop for people arriving by boat or coming off the beach.

What dishes are most recommended at The Flora-Bama Yacht Club?

Frequent recommendations include fried crab claws, tuna dip, crab cakes, blackened grouper, grouper po boy, shrimp tacos, Ahi Tuna nachos, and gumbo. Several reviewers also mention having their catch cooked Greek style, which they describe as especially good.

What is the atmosphere like at The Flora-Bama Yacht Club?

The vibe is laid-back and casual, with outdoor seating, beach views, and live music or even live duet performances. Reviewers describe it as family-friendly and comfortable for kids, but also a good place for adults to relax with drinks and music.

Is The Flora-Bama Yacht Club good value, and what does it cost?

The restaurant is in the $20 to $30 range, and reviewers often say the food, service, and setting make it worth the price. People mention generous portions and strong value from dishes like crab cakes, grouper platters, and seafood appetizers paired with cocktails or beer.

When is the best time to visit The Flora-Bama Yacht Club?

Reviewers say it works well for lunch and also for a stop after a day on the water, especially when you want the outdoor seating and bay views. It can stay comfortable even when weather changes, since staff have moved guests inside quickly without disrupting service.
